1. Impedance Characteristics of the Finite‐Length Annular Induction MHD Generator

An analysis of the annular induction MHD (magnetohydrodynamic) generator is carried out for a model employing a finite‐length winding and a constant‐velocity fluid flowing in the annulus. An expression for the phase impedance is derived which accounts for entrance and exit of the fluid into the winding region. Impedance characteristics are presented which allow comparison with the infinite‐length case in terms of dimensionless parameters.
